Easy Double Choc Coconut Traybake Recipe

This double choc coconut traybake is the perfect treat for chocolate lovers. It's easy to make and can be enjoyed by people of all ages.

Ingredients

- 1 cup self-raising flour - 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der - 1/2 teaspoon baking powder - 1/4 teaspoon baking soda - 1/4 teaspoon salt - 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ened - 1/2 cup granulated sugar - 2 large eggs - 1 teaspoon vanilla extract - 1 cup semisweet chocolate chips - 1 cup unsweetened shredded coconut

Instructions

1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ease and flour a 9x13 inch baking pan. 2. In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. 3. In a large b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la. 4.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until just combined. Fold in the chocolate chips and coconut. 5. Spread the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. 6. Allow the traybake to cool completely before cutting into squares and serving.
